The Unassigned Devices plugin will allow you to mount shares from other computers on your unRAID server. That could allow you to access your Ubuntu files directly on your unRAID server.

July 23, 201510 yr Author For anyone suffering this problem check y our adapter settings. I had a network bridge setup however, I had removed my Ceton card that I had been bridged with. Messed up everything! Hope this helps someone else lol.
